81 lines
3.7 KiB
PHP
81 lines
3.7 KiB
PHP
@extends('admin.layout')
|
|
|
|
@section('title', ($equipo ? 'Editar' : 'Nuevo') . ' Equipo - Admin OnAPB')
|
|
|
|
@section('content')
|
|
<div class="page-header">
|
|
<h2><i class="bi bi-people-fill"></i> {{ $equipo ? 'Editar Equipo' : 'Nuevo Equipo' }}</h2>
|
|
<a href="{{ route('admin.equipos.index') }}" class="btn-admin-outline">
|
|
<i class="bi bi-arrow-left"></i> Volver
|
|
</a>
|
|
</div>
|
|
|
|
<div class="admin-card">
|
|
<div class="card-body">
|
|
<form method="POST" action="{{ $equipo ? route('admin.equipos.update', $equipo->id_equipo) : route('admin.equipos.store') }}" class="admin-form">
|
|
@csrf
|
|
@if($equipo) @method('PUT') @endif
|
|
|
|
<div class="row">
|
|
@if(session('admin_role') == 1)
|
|
<div class="col-md-6">
|
|
<div class="mb-3">
|
|
<label class="form-label">Club *</label>
|
|
<select name="id_club" class="form-select" required>
|
|
<option value="">Seleccionar club...</option>
|
|
@foreach($clubes as $club)
|
|
<option value="{{ $club->id_club }}" {{ old('id_club', $equipo->id_club ?? '') == $club->id_club ? 'selected' : '' }}>
|
|
{{ $club->nombre }}
|
|
</option>
|
|
@endforeach
|
|
</select>
|
|
@error('id_club')
|
|
<div class="text-danger small mt-1">{{ $message }}</div>
|
|
@enderror
|
|
</div>
|
|
</div>
|
|
@else
|
|
<input type="hidden" name="id_club" value="{{ session('admin_id_club') }}">
|
|
@endif
|
|
<div class="col-md-{{ session('admin_role') == 1 ? '4' : '6' }}">
|
|
<div class="mb-3">
|
|
<label class="form-label">Categoría *</label>
|
|
<select name="categoria" class="form-select" required>
|
|
<option value="">Seleccionar categoría...</option>
|
|
@foreach($categorias as $cat)
|
|
<option value="{{ $cat->nombre }}" {{ old('categoria', $equipo->categoria ?? '') == $cat->nombre ? 'selected' : '' }}>
|
|
{{ $cat->nombre }}
|
|
</option>
|
|
@endforeach
|
|
</select>
|
|
@error('categoria')
|
|
<div class="text-danger small mt-1">{{ $message }}</div>
|
|
@enderror
|
|
</div>
|
|
</div>
|
|
<div class="col-md-2">
|
|
<div class="mb-3">
|
|
<label class="form-label">División *</label>
|
|
<select name="division" class="form-select" required>
|
|
<option value="">Seleccionar...</option>
|
|
@foreach(['A', 'B', 'C', 'D'] as $div)
|
|
<option value="{{ $div }}" {{ old('division', $equipo->division ?? '') == $div ? 'selected' : '' }}>
|
|
{{ $div }}
|
|
</option>
|
|
@endforeach
|
|
</select>
|
|
@error('division')
|
|
<div class="text-danger small mt-1">{{ $message }}</div>
|
|
@enderror
|
|
</div>
|
|
</div>
|
|
</div>
|
|
|
|
<button type="submit" class="btn-admin">
|
|
<i class="bi bi-check-lg"></i> {{ $equipo ? 'Actualizar' : 'Crear Equipo' }}
|
|
</button>
|
|
</form>
|
|
</div>
|
|
</div>
|
|
@endsection
|